Japan lures travelers with its enchanting culture, picturesque landscapes, and bustling cities. From the ancient temples of Kyoto to the modern metropolis of Tokyo, Japan offers an unforgettable experience for every https://socialmediainuk.com/story20541652/journey-through-japan-s-top-tourist-attractions